I think I have found the diamond I am seeking, but I am wondering whether I should worry about the feather, the natural, and the indented natural.

The diamond: https://www.jamesallen.com/loose-di...i-color-vs2-clarity-excellent-cut-sku-3596799

It has an HCA cut score of 1.3 (excellent scintillation, fire, and brilliance), VS2, I color, excellent cut. A gemologist at James Allen has assured me it is eye clean, so the clouds and crystal on top of the table aren’t a huge concern.

The Ideal Scope Image looks good enough to me:
B577C29A-EE87-42CA-99A1-4B0EF1F10BE9.jpeg


I have attached the GIA report, which shows the diamond’s inclusions. The inclusions that give me pause are the feather(s), the natural, and the indented natural. I read somewhere the feathers can be problematic because they can become bigger cracks and indicate that the diamond is not stable and or durable. I think I read something similar/ or can imagine something similar being the case with the naturals. I am happy with this diamond otherwise, and am wondering whether my concerns are legitimate or misplaced. Should I be worried? Any other thoughts are appreciated.

The diamond has a great IS and great angle. So wonderful. I'd worry a bit about the clouds. Clouds can create a snow-globe effect causing light to scatter (bad) and this is listed with a cloud and 'additional clouds'. You'll need to get the JA gemologist (not sales associate) to view the diamond to tell you if the clouds are an issue. I'd really rather they were off toward the girdle. As a VS, I would hope this is not a huge deal...but, you gotta ask.

Thank you. I’ve asked the gemologist at JA about the eye cleanliness of the stone. He or she has assured me it is eye clean. Therefor, the clouds are not a big issue. Wondering about the feather, the natural, and the indented natural and how they impact durability. Any thoughts on those?
 
At a VS2 the inclusions should not affect the durability of the stone. It does look like a nice stone...as long as cleared by the gemologist like RS mentioned
you should be good to go.
 
Very nice IS - love the smaller table and fatter arrows :love: the inclusion shouldn't be an issue in a VS2 but inspect in different lighting once you receive it to make sure it's acceptable to you!
